Understanding the Price Point: Omega Seamaster Rose Gold Price
The price of an Omega Seamaster rose gold watch varies considerably depending on several key factors. The most significant is the amount and type of gold used. While some models may feature a rose gold bezel on a stainless steel case, others boast entirely 18k Sedna gold cases and bracelets, dramatically increasing the cost. The caliber of the movement also plays a crucial role. More complex movements, such as chronographs or those with special features like co-axial escapements, command higher prices. Finally, the condition of the watch (pre-owned versus new) and its specific features (dial color, complications) all contribute to the overall price. The $5,105.00 figure mentioned serves as a starting point, representing a potential entry-level price for a pre-owned or simpler rose gold Seamaster model. Expect significantly higher prices, often well into the tens of thousands of dollars, for high-end, fully gold models with complications.
Exploring the Details: Omega Seamaster Gold Bezel
The rose gold bezel is a defining characteristic of many Seamaster models. It adds a touch of refined luxury to the otherwise sporty design, creating a beautiful contrast against the dial and case. The bezel's function is primarily to serve as a timing bezel, allowing divers to track elapsed time underwater. However, in the context of a rose gold Seamaster, the bezel becomes more than just a functional element; it's a statement of style and sophistication. The quality of the rose gold bezel is paramount, reflecting Omega's commitment to using only high-grade materials. The precise craftsmanship ensures a smooth, consistent finish, contributing to the overall luxurious feel of the watch. The bezel's design can vary across different Seamaster models, from simple unidirectional bezels to more complex designs with intricate detailing.
